Cutting Thickness Capability
Choosing the right plasma cutter hinges on understanding its cutting thickness capability, as this determines how effectively you can work with various materials. Plasma cutters typically offer clean cuts from 1/4 inch (6mm) to 1/2 inch (12mm) at lower voltages. For thicker materials, look for machines that can cut up to 3/4 inch (20mm) or more at higher amperages. Remember, a 50 Amp machine can handle 5/8 inch (16mm) at 220V but may only manage 3/8 inch (10mm) at 110V. Features like pilot arc technology enhance performance on dirty surfaces, while duty cycle ratings impact continuous operation. Finally, consider the recommended air pressure and flow rate to guarantee ideal cutting quality across various thicknesses.

Arc Technology Types
Selecting the right arc technology can greatly impact your metalworking efficiency and outcomes. Plasma cutters utilize various arc technologies, each with unique benefits. Non-touch pilot arc systems let you cut through dirty, rusted, or coated surfaces without contact, improving cutting quality and prolonging consumable life. On the other hand, high-frequency arc technology offers rapid and stable arc initiation for smoother cuts but may interfere with other electronic devices. IGBT technology enhances power conversion and provides better control over voltage and current. Additionally, digital control systems allow for precise adjustments, elevating cut quality. When choosing between high-frequency and non-high frequency systems, consider your project’s intricacies and material conditions to guarantee maximum versatility and performance.
User-Friendly Features
What makes a plasma cutter truly user-friendly? Look for large LED displays that provide real-time metrics like air pressure, voltage, and current, making monitoring a breeze. Dual operational modes, such as 2T and 4T, enhance usability for longer tasks by allowing you to switch between semi-automatic and automatic cutting control. Customizable post-flow cooling settings are essential too; they help extend consumable life by letting you adjust cooling times based on your cutting conditions. Error code displays and air pressure sensors simplify troubleshooting, so you won’t need to remove protective gear to make adjustments. Finally, choose models with quick setup features, like built-in air regulators, so you can start cutting in minimal time.
Safety and Durability
When you’re in the market for a plasma cutter, considering safety and durability is essential to guarantee both your well-being and the longevity of your equipment. Look for safety features like overload protection, overheating safeguards, and a good water ingress rating, such as IP21. These attributes protect you and extend your machine’s life. Durable designs often use corrosion-resistant materials and advanced cooling systems, which minimize wear and tear. Automatic post-flow cooling functions keep the torch cool after use, enhancing consumable lifespan. Verify the cutter complies with industry standards, like ANSI and FCC certifications, to confirm reliability. Finally, fault alarms and error codes on digital displays help you quickly identify issues, further promoting operational safety.
